"I wanted to revolutionize the Internet," says Ingrid Vanderveldt, president and co-founder of Dryken Technologies, "and create something of value that would help people find more time to spend on things that are really important." Vanderveldt and co-founder Lyn Graft carry out that vision by developing software to help e-commerce retailers understand their customers, thus providing them with a unique, ultimate shopping experience.
"Hiring the right people to help you succeed is the most important asset you have as an entrepreneur," says Graft. They surround themselves with people who have passion, drive, creativity, smarts, a belief that they too can change the world, and a shared vision of the company. "Part of the advantage we have in the market is the relationship we have with our employees," Vanderveldt says.
Graft sees starting a business as one of the hardest, but by far the most rewarding, experiences he has ever gone through. "Put forth your entire effort and remember that if you are not excited about what you are doing, no one else will be." Vanderveldt counts her beliefs about success as her greatest asset as well as her greatest challenge. "You can do whatever you want as long as you really want it. When you are aligned with your vision the world pulls together to conspire to make your dream happen."
